  • Posted

    Hi everyone,been reading through all the posts a few ups and downs but good to see everyone digging in.

    I actually feel quite good but after my latest results the specialist wants to me to go back on the carbs at a low dose of 10 mg.

    My tsh was 0.09 and t4 18.1 He wants to see me again in 2 months with a view to have a second lot of treatment of RAI.

    I really am against having another dose of treatment as i would rather stay on the carbs and hope the graves goes into remission as i have been alot better than i was.

    Anyones opinions would be very helpful and appreciated,take care baz
